bacon drippings to a saucepan.

Bring drippings, milk, and butter to a boil over medium heat.

Gradually whisk in grits, 1 tsp.

salt, and 12 tsp.

pepper; cook, whisking constantly, 15 minutes or until very thick.

Remove from heat; let stand 10 minutes.

Stir in 1 cup cheese; let stand 10 minutes.

Stir in 1 egg; spread in a 9-inch springform pan coated with cooking spray.

Bake at 350F for 25 minutes or until set and browned.

Sprinkle remaining 1 12 cups cheese over warm grits, spreading to edges.

Let stand 15 minutes.

Reduce oven temperature to 325F.

Combine half-and-half, cream, onions, and remaining 5 eggs, 1 tsp.

salt, and 12 tsp.

Pour over grits; sprinkle with crumbled bacon.

Place pan on a foil-lined baking sheet.

Bake at 325F for 1 hour and 15 minutes or until lightly browned and just set.

Let stand 20 minutes.

Run a sharp knife around edges of quiche; remove sides of pan.
